Abstract

The invention relates to a movement charging device for fixed adhesive tape chain-drive section, which comprises a main carriage, multisection auxiliary carriages, a carriage orbit, a winch, a movement weight tensioning device and a fixed funnel, wherein the main carriage and the auxiliary carriages are connected by connecting links, the main carriage and the auxiliary carriages are installed on the carriage orbit, the winch is connected with the top of the main carriage, the movement weight tensioning device is connected with the main carriage and the auxiliary carriages, and the bottom of the carriage orbit is provided with the fixed funnel. The device has reasonable structure design, can realize multipoint charge, reduce material transporting drop height, and solve the shortage on the multipoint charging aspect of the bulk material transporting art and the device.

Background technology
At the loose unpacked material transport field, when production technology needs a bit to give 2 feed respectively, adopt usually: the mode of (1) threeway sub-material; (2) move chute; (3) reversible belt.Because the flowing power of material is different, threeway sub-material, mobile chute feed need increase very high drop, could satisfy the Flow of Goods and Materials requirement, and the material drop is very big, promptly increase construction investment and have increased the broken loss of material again, cause and produce unnecessary waste.Reversible belt need increase one deck transhipment, and civil engineering costs is that height increases a broken loss of material again.
When production technology needs a bit to give respectively or multiple spot feed at 3, must adopt and move belt and accomplish, this kind mode transfer point length, highly all will increase a lot, increase a broken loss of material, move belt such as reversible operation, easy sideslip causes spreading.

The specific embodiment
See Fig. 1, Fig. 2; A kind of movement charging device for fixed adhesive tape chain-drive section; Comprise main car 1, the secondary car 3 of more piece, car body track 5, winch 7, ground fixed mount 38, heavy-hammer tension device 6 and fixed funnel 4, link to each other through pipe link 2 between main car 1 and the secondary car 3 and between secondary car 3 and the secondary car 3 that main car 1 and secondary car 3 are installed on the car body track 5; Main car 1 rear is provided with ground fixed mount 38; Winch 7 is connected with main car 1 head, and heavy-hammer tension device 6 is connected with main car 1, secondary car 3 through adhesive tape, and car body track 5 bottoms are provided with fixed funnel 4.
See Fig. 3, Fig. 4; Main car 1 side is equipped with driving device 16; Main car 1 head is installed running block 14, and driving drum 15 is installed at main car 1 middle part, and driving drum 15 is connected with driving device 16; Driving drum 15 back is arranged side by side with it is provided with changed course cylinder 17, and changed course cylinder 17 is connected with heavy-hammer tension device 6 through adhesive tape; Securement head funnel 11 on the main car 1, main car 1 rear upper end is installed three groups of master's car upper supporting rollers 13.Main car 1 is provided with anti-tipping registration device 12, and anti-tipping registration device 12 is formed (Figure 13) by inhibiting device fixed mount 43, limiting stopper 44 and bearing pin 45.Main car 1 the place ahead is provided with fixed pulley group 8, connects through steel cable between winch 7, fixed pulley group 8 and the running block 14.
See Fig. 5, driving device 16 comprises reductor 19, coupler 21, electrical motor 22 and base 18, and 15 coaxial connections of driving drum on reductor 19 1 ends and the main car 1, an end is connected with electrical motor 22 through coupler 21; A support wheel 20 is installed in base 18 bottoms, and driving device 16 is walked on driving device track 10 through support wheel 20.The end of the base 18 of driving device 16 is equipped with connecting rod mechanism 23, and driving device 16 links to each other with main car 1 through connecting rod mechanism 23, forms four-bar linkage.
See Fig. 6; Comprise upper supporting roller group 24, oscillating type snub pulley group 25, secondary car inhibiting device 26 and set of wheels 27 on the secondary car 3 of every joint; Upper supporting roller group 24 is arranged on secondary car 3 upper ends; Oscillating type snub pulley group 25 is arranged on secondary car 3 lower ends, and oscillating type snub pulley group 25 belows are provided with secondary car inhibiting device 26, and secondary car 3 bottoms are provided with set of wheels 27.
See Fig. 7, car body track 5 is divided into upper segment 28, middle transition section 29, lower section 30, and car body track 5 front portions are provided with track inhibiting device 9, and car body track 5 can adopt angle steel to process also can to adopt light rail to process.When main car 1 is heavier, adopt light rail to install, when adopting light rail to install, it is spacing that car body is provided with horizontal guide sheave.The upper segment 28 of track can be an integral body, also can be divided into two parts and corresponding with main car 1, secondary car 3 respectively.Constant, secondary car 3 tracks of master's car 1 orbit altitude are divided into upper segment 28, middle transition section 29, lower section 30 in the time of separately, in the time of separately master's car 1, secondary car 3 tracks and when merging into same track functions of use identical.
See Figure 10, Figure 11; Ground fixed mount 38 comprises roller rack 39, trough girder upper supporting roller group 40, ground fixedly snub pulley group 41 and supporting track 42, roller rack 39 tops fixed installation trough girder upper supporting roller group 40, and fixedly snub pulley group 41 of ground is installed in roller rack 39 bottoms; Fixedly snub pulley group 41 can be rotated by hinge along the bottom; When secondary car 3 during not in track lower section 30, fixedly snub pulley group 41 is in vertical position, otherwise is horizontal.Trough girder upper supporting roller group 40 belows are provided with supporting track 42, and the height of supporting track 42 is highly consistent with oscillating type snub pulley group 25.
See Fig. 8, Fig. 9; Heavy-hammer tension device 6 comprises guiding wheels 35, weight box 36, weight changed course cylinder 32, tensioning changed course cylinder 33, guide track 37 and inspection platform 34; The vertical installation of guide track 37 on the ground; Guiding wheels 35 both sides with match at guide track 37, weight box 36 is connected with guiding wheels 35, the weight cylinder 32 that alters course passes through adhesive tape and the tensioning cylinder 33 that alters course and is connected; Heavy-hammer tension device 6 both sides are respectively equipped with the inspection platform 34 of a band safety rail, and inspection platform 34 is connected with weight box 36.When heavy-hammer tension device 6 runs on; Lean on track adjusting wheel control service direction; Inspection platform 34 is connected with weight box 36 and with weight box 36 1 liftings, service personnel can get into inspection platform 34, maintenance heavy-hammer tension device 6 through being located at ground vertical cat ladder 31.Heavy-hammer tension device 6 stroke heights should be adhesive tape development length and sealing-tape machine head shift motion sum.When stroke height is not enough, can adopt two cover heavy-hammer tension devices 6 to realize.
See Fig. 1, Fig. 2; Main car 1 leans on wire rope hoist 7 traction steel rope of cable with secondary car 3 ahead runnings; Running block 14 through on the main car 1 of cover fixed pulley group 8 tractions drives main car 1 and secondary car 3 ahead runnings; Main car 1 is during with secondary car 3 ahead runnings, tape elongation be lean on heavy-hammer tension device 6 tensioning changed course cylinder 33 upwards operation realize; When main car 1 moves with secondary car 3 backward, winch 7 counter-rotatings, the power that car body moves is to lean on heavy-hammer tension device 6 automatically downward tightening forces, draws driving drum 15 on the main car 1 through adhesive tape, thereby reaches the purpose of main car 1 of traction and secondary car 3 motions.
See Fig. 6, Fig. 7, owing to secondary car 3 moves on the orbital plane of upper segment 28, middle transition section 29 and lower section 30, so oscillating type snub pulley group 25 roll surface height change; For the lower belt surface bearing height that keeps adhesive tape constant; Establish a pair of fixedly hinge at the support afterbody of oscillating type snub pulley group 25, oscillating type snub pulley group 25 is swung around hinge, when secondary car 3 is on upper track; The support of oscillating type snub pulley group 25 is to lean on secondary car upper bracket to accomplish; When secondary car during to the bottom orbital motion, the support wheel of oscillating type snub pulley group 25 is walked on supporting track 42, thereby keeps the lower belt surface height of adhesive tape constant.
